Oscar-nominated actor Colman Domingo is in talks to co-write a live-action film centered on Princess Tiana, inspired by Disney’s 2009 animated hit The Princess and the Frog.
According to The Hollywood Reporter, Domingo will collaborate with Tony-nominated director Robert O’Hara on the project, though deals have yet to be finalized. The film is not expected to be a direct remake of The Princess and the Frog, but rather a new story inspired by the beloved animated classic.
The development comes after Disney shelved its planned Princess and the Frog animated series for Disney+, shifting its focus to a new feature centered on Tiana.
Domingo is best known for his acclaimed performances in Rustin, Sing Sing, Euphoria, The Color Purple and Fear the Walking Dead.
